1. Start Your Day With Stillness, Not Scrolling

Why It Elevates You:

Waking up and diving into chaos (emails, notifications, gossip) throws off your energy. Elegant people start their mornings with clarity and calm—because composure is a luxury in a noisy world.

“A refined mind isn’t rushed. It’s deliberate.”

How to Practice It:

  • Begin with 5 minutes of silence, journaling, or slow breathing.
  • Sip your tea or coffee mindfully.
  • Avoid social media for the first hour. Let your mind stretch before the world grabs it.

2. Practice Posture Like It’s a Power Move

Why It Elevates You:

You could wear a designer suit—but if you’re slouching, it looks like it’s wearing you. Posture communicates presence. A straight back, lifted chin, and grounded stance signal elegance instantly.

“Before you even speak, your posture already told the room who you are.”

How to Practice It:

  • Imagine a string pulling you gently from the crown of your head.
  • Shoulders back, spine neutral, neck long.
  • When you sit, don’t melt into the chair rest with grace.

3. Speak With Precision, Not Filler

Why It Elevates You:

When you choose your words with care, it conveys respect—for yourself and for your listener. It signals that your thoughts are considered and valuable. 

Words build your image faster than fashion. Elegant people speak clearly, calmly, and with intent. They don’t rush. They don’t fumble. They don’t overtalk.

“Sophistication isn’t in sounding smart. It’s in speaking simply—with impact.”

How to Practice It:

  • Pause before you speak.
  • Replace fillers like “uh,” “like,” and “you know” with silence.
  • Speak in complete, intentional sentences. Less chatter, more substance.

Simple Tips on Practising Your Speech:

man speaking in front of mirror praticing his speech

Mirror Practice: “Stand or sit in front of a mirror and practice speaking. Observe your facial expressions and body language as you articulate your thoughts. Notice any nervous habits or filler words that creep in.”

Voice Recording (and Listening!): “Record yourself speaking on various topics. The key is not just to record but to listen back critically. You’ll become much more aware of your verbal tics and areas for improvement.”

Conscious Conversation: “During everyday conversations, make a deliberate effort to be mindful of your word choices. Before responding, take that brief pause and formulate your sentence. It might feel slow at first, but it builds a powerful habit.”

Read Aloud: “Reading well-written articles or speeches aloud can help you internalize the rhythm and flow of articulate language.”

5. Mind Your Surroundings—Tidy Up Like You’re Hosting Royalty

Why It Elevates You:
A chaotic space reflects a chaotic mind. Elegant people treat their surroundings with care, whether it’s a tiny apartment or a luxury suite. Order, cleanliness, and ambiance speak louder than price tags.

“The most sophisticated lives are often the simplest—just curated beautifully.”

How to Practice It:

  • Make your bed every morning.
  • Keep your work desk minimalist and clean.
  • Light a candle, open a window, or play soft instrumental music to set the mood.

6. Move With Grace—Every Step Is a Statement

Model Walking

Why It Elevates You:
The way you walk, sit, turn your head, or carry a glass—it all adds up. Graceful movement whispers class. Abrupt, rushed movements look careless. Slow, intentional movements feel royal.

“Elegance isn’t just seen. It’s felt—in how you move through the world.”

How to Practice It:

  • Walk as if you own the room—not in arrogance, but in calm command.
  • Sit and rise without slamming into furniture.
  • Handle objects gently. Even closing a door softly is a flex.

Graceful Movements to Practice: Break it down into actionable steps:

  • The Elegant Walk: “Imagine a line extending from your spine through the crown of your head. Walk with a moderate stride, allowing your arms to swing naturally. Avoid jerky or hurried steps. Land softly on your heels and roll through to your toes.”
  • The Graceful Sit: “Approach a chair mindfully. Bend your knees slightly and lower yourself gently, maintaining a straight back. Avoid collapsing or plopping down.”
  • The Elegant Rise: “Push off gently with your feet, keeping your back straight and your movements fluid. Avoid using your arms excessively for leverage.”
  • Handling Objects with Care: “Whether it’s picking up a pen or pouring a drink, perform each action with deliberate care. Notice the weight and texture of the object. Avoid abrupt grabbing or clanging.”
  • The Gentle Turn: “When turning, move your head first, followed by your shoulders and then your body. This creates a smooth and elegant flow rather than a sharp pivot.”

7. Use Scent Like an Aura, Not a Weapon

Coco Chanel’s Iconic No. 5

Why It Elevates You:
Smell is memory. The right scent makes people remember you. Elegant people don’t drown in perfume—they leave a hint, like a whisper behind a curtain.

Consider your personal style and the types of scents you naturally gravitate towards—floral, woody, citrusy, spicy? Visit a department store or perfumery and sample different fragrances on your skin, allowing them to develop over a few hours. What smells wonderful in the bottle might react differently with your body chemistry.

Think about the occasions you’ll be wearing the scent. A lighter, fresher fragrance might be perfect for daytime, while a richer, more complex scent could be ideal for evening.

“Let your scent arrive softly and leave slowly—just like your presence.”

How to Practice It:

  • Find a signature scent—one that suits your mood and personality.
  • Apply it subtly: pulse points (wrists, neck, behind ears).
  • Avoid overpowering others—elegance never suffocates.

Classy Perfumes for Women: Offer a diverse range of styles:

  • Timeless Florals: Chanel No. 5 (classic aldehyde floral), Dior J’adore (modern fruity floral), Jo Malone London Peony & Blush Suede (soft, romantic floral).
  • Elegant Woods & Chypre: Guerlain Mitsouko (classic chypre with peach), Hermès Twilly d’Hermès (ginger, tuberose, sandalwood), Narciso Rodriguez For Her (musky floral woody).
  • Fresh & Citrusy: Acqua di Parma Colonia (iconic Italian citrus), Byredo Bal d’Afrique (bright and woody), Atelier Cologne Clémentine California (sparkling citrus).
  • Sophisticated Orientals: Yves Saint Laurent Black Opium (modern gourmand oriental), Tom Ford Black Orchid (dark and opulent), Shalimar Eau de Parfum (classic vanilla oriental).

Recommend Classy Colognes for Men: Again, aim for variety:

  • Leather & Tobacco: Tom Ford Tobacco Vanille (warm and opulent), Byredo Tobacco Mandarin (vibrant and spicy), Acqua di Parma Colonia Leather Eau de Cologne Concentrée (sophisticated leather citrus)
  • Classic & Woody: Creed Aventus (fruity chypre with smoky notes), Terre d’Hermès (earthy and woody), Tom Ford Grey Vetiver (clean and sophisticated vetiver).
  • Fresh & Citrusy: Acqua di Parma Colonia Essenza (refined citrus with woody undertones), Dior Eau Sauvage (timeless citrus aromatic), Maison Francis Kurkdjian Aqua Universalis (fresh and luminous).
  • Spicy & Aromatic: Yves Saint Laurent La Nuit de L’Homme (spicy and alluring), Bleu de Chanel (woody aromatic with citrus), Viktor & Rolf Spicebomb Extreme (warm and intense spice).
